#248e50 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#248e50 is composed of 14.1% red, 55.7%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 43.7%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 144.9 degrees, a saturation of 59.6% and a lightness of 34.9%. #248e50 color hex could be obtained by blending #48ffa0 with #001d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#248e50 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#248e50 has RGB values of R:36, G:142,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0, Y:0.44,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 2395728.

Shades and Tints of #248e50
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1fbf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#248e50
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#545e58 is the less saturated color, while #02b04a is the most saturated one.
